In the Civil War era, almost everybody sang and typically knew a substantial body of songs. One of the adaptations in this collection of songs favoring the South and secession features Abraham Lincoln and is given the title “Lincoln Going to Canaan,” based on a widely-known song, “The Happy Land of Canaan.”
Hopkins New Orleans 5 Cent Song-Book
[New Orleans, John Hopkins, 1861]
A 861h
